  • Experimental realization of a concatenated Greenberger-Horne-Zeilinger state for macroscopic quantum superpositions

    • 摘要:

      The Greenberger-Horne-Zeilinger (GHZ) states play a significant role in fundamental tests of quantum mechanics and are one of the central resources of quantum-enhanced high-precision metrology, fault-tolerant quantum computing and distributed quantum networks. However, in a noisy environment, entanglement becomes fragile as the particle number increases. Recently, a concatenated GHZ (C-GHZ) state, which retains the advantages of conventional GHZ states but is more robust in a noisy environment, was proposed. Here, we experimentally prepare a three-logical-qubit C-GHZ state. By characterizing the dynamics of entanglement quality of the C-GHZ state under simple collective noise, we demonstrate that the C-GHZ state is more robust than the conventional GHZ state. Our work provides an essential tool for quantum-enhanced measurement and enables a new route to prepare and manipulate macroscopic entanglement. Our result is also useful for linear-optical quantum computation schemes whose building blocks are GHZ-type states.

  • An efficient quantum light-matter interface with sub-second lifetime

    • 摘要:

      Quantum repeaters hold promise for scalable long-distance quantum communication. The basic building block is a quantum light-matter interface that generates non-classical correlations between light and a quantum memory. Significant progress has been made in improving the performance of this interface, but further development of quantum repeater is hindered by the difficulty of integrating the key capabilities into a single system. Here we report a high-performance interface with an efficiency and lifetime that fulfil the requirement of a quantum repeater. By confining cold atoms with a three-dimensional optical lattice and enhancing the atom-photon coupling with a ring cavity, we observe an initial retrieval efficiency of 76 ± 5% together with a 1/e lifetime of 0.22 ± 0.01s, which supports a sub-Hz entanglement distribution of up to 1,000km through the Duan-Lukin-Cirac-Zoller (DLCZ) protocol. Together with an efficient telecom interface and moderate multiplexing, our result may enable a quantum repeater system that beats direct transmission in the near future.

  • Advanced quantum communication based on multi-photon entanglement

    • 摘要:

      We present several experimental progresses for advanced quantum communication based on multi-photon entanglement. Quantum secret sharing (QSS) and third-man quantum cryptograph (TQC) shows the advancement in multi-party quantum communication. Quantum error rejection (QER) holds the promise for error-free transfer in long-distance quantum communication. Fault-tolerant quantum cryptography in a decoherence-free subspace (DFS) and quantum-relay-assisted key distribution respectively overcome the difficulties caused by decoherence and photon loss, the two main crucial problems in long-distance quantum communication.

  • Root border cell development is a temperature-insensitive and Al-sensitive process in barley

    • 摘要:

      In vivo and in vitro experiments showed that border cell (BC) survival was dependent on root tip mucigel in barley (Hordeum vulgare L. cv. Hang 981). In aeroponic culture, BC development was an induced process in barley, whereas in hydroponic culture, it was a kinetic equilibrium process during which 300-400 BCs were released into water daily. The response of root elongation to temperatures (10-35°C) was very sensitive but temperature changes had no great effect on barley BC development. At 35°C, the root elongation ceased whereas BC production still continued, indicating that the two processes might be regulated independently under high temperature (35°C) stress. Fifty μM Al could inhibit significantly BC development by inhibiting pectin methylesterase activity in the root cap of cv. 2000-2 (Al-sensitive) and cv. Humai 16 (Al-tolerant), but 20 μM Al could not block BC development in cv. Humai 16. BCs and their mucigel of barley had a limited role in the protection of Al-induced inhibition of root elongation, but played a significant role in the prevention of Al from diffusing into the meristems of the root tip and the root cap. Together, these results suggested that BC development was a temperature-insensitive but Al-sensitive process, and that BCs and their mucigel played an important role in the protection of root tip and root cap meristems from Al toxicity.

  • Experimental synchronization of independent entangled photon sources

    • 摘要:

      We report the generation of independent entangled photon pairs from two synchronized but mutually incoherent laser sources. The quality of synchronization is confirmed by observing a violation of Bell's inequality with 3.2 standard deviations in an entanglement swapping experiment. The techniques developed in our experiment are not only important for realistic linear optical quantum-information processing, but also enable new tests of local realism.

  • Expression of endothelial nitric oxide synthase and vascular endothelial growth factor in association with neovascularization in human primary astrocytoma

    • 摘要:

      Objective: To investigate the relationship between the expression of endothelial nitric oxide synthase (eNOS), vascular endothelial growth factor (VEGF) and angiogenesis in primary astrocytoma. Methods: Thirty-seven primary astrocytomas and 4 astrocytic hyperplasia samples were collected and divided into three groups according to histological grade. The expression of eNOS, VEGF and factor VIII related antigen (FVIIIRAg) were assayed by immunohistochemistry. Microvascular density was assessed by FVIIIRAg immunoreactivity. The intensity of immunoreactivity was graded according to the percentage of positive tumor cells. Results: No eNOS and VEGF were expressed in the astrocytes and vascular endothelium in astrocytic hyperplasia. The expression of eNOS or VEGF was light in low-grade astrocytoma and strong in glioblastoma. eNOS expression in astrocytoma was very positively correlated with VEGF. eNOS and VEGF expression in anaplastic astrocytoma was median in contrast to the low grade astrocytoma and glioblastoma. Lower microvascular density was found in low grade astrocytoma than that in higher grade malignant ones. The expressions of eNOS and VEGF were correlated with microvascular density and tumor malignancy. Conclusion: This finding suggests that eNOS and VEGF may have cooperative effect in tumor angiogenesis and play an important role in the pathogenesis of primary astrocytoma.

  • Progress in nonribosomal peptide synthetases

    • 摘要:

      Some important peptides of bacterial or fungal origin are synthesized via a template-directed, nucleic-acid-independent nonribosomal mechanism. Recent studies revealed that there is a special kind of macroenzymes, nonribosomal peptide synthetases, which plays a key role in the alternative system. Nonribosomal peptide synthetases are composed of modules, the sequences of which contain the message for peptide synthesis. The understanding of the structure and function of nonribosomal peptide synthetases enables scientists believe that some new peptides can be produced by modifying or recombining these special enzymes.

  • Highly indistinguishable on-demand resonance fluorescence photons from a deterministic quantum dot micropillar device with 74% extraction efficiency

    • 摘要:

      The implementation and engineering of bright and coherent solid state quantum light sources is key for the realization of both on chip and remote quantum networks. Despite tremendous efforts for more than 15 years, the combination of these two key prerequisites in a single, potentially scalable device is a major challenge. Here, we report on the observation of bright single photon emission generated via pulsed, resonance fluorescence conditions from a single quantum dot (QD) deterministically centered in a micropillar cavity device via cryogenic optical lithography. The brightness of the QD fluorescence is greatly enhanced on resonance with the fundamental mode of the pillar, leading to an overall device efficiency of η = (74 ± 4) % for a single photon emission as pure as g(2)(0) = 0.0092 ± 0.0004. The combination of large Purcell enhancement and resonant pumping conditions allows us to observe a two-photon wave packet overlap up to ν = (88±3) %.
